Subject: [OASIS Issue Tracker] Updated: (MQTT-57) Will Flag checking


     [ http://tools.oasis-open.org/issues/browse/MQTT-57?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:all-tabpanel ]

Richard Coppen updated MQTT-57:
-------------------------------

        Summary: Will Flag checking  (was: Section 3.1.2.3.4. if the will flag is zero the will retain flag must also be set to zero)
    Description: 
Section 3.1.2.3.2WD07 line 630: "The Will Retain flag has no meaning if the Will flag is 0" is a little vague, we should put the flag in a known state.

Section 3.1.2.3.3 "Will QoS" The server is not required to validate the Qill QoS if the Will Flag is set to 0

  was:WD07 line 630: "The Will Retain flag has no meaning if the Will flag is 0" is a little vague, we should put the flag in a known state.

       Proposal: 
If the Will Flag is set to 0, then the Will Retain Flag MUST be set to 0
If the Will Flag is set to 0, then the Will QoS MUST be set to 0
